Walden

This place has some of the worst course conditions I've seen. Pretty much every aspect of the course was in bad shape. Tee boxes were half dirt. Greens were burnt out. Fairways weren't much different from the rough. It's a shame cause the layout is actually decent and pretty interesting. It's a very tight course and punishes anything slightly offline. No water coolers and no cart ladies, which just added insult to injury in the heat. It might be acceptable if the price was really cheap, but it wasn't even that cheap at around $60. I could look the other way if this was a $30 course, but it doesn't provide the quality you'd expect at its price point.

Walden Golf Club

I rated this course somewhat challenging because it isn't in great shape, but that may be a function of their budget. They've lost sections of some greens, and fairways are a mix of burned out areas, nice grass, weeds, and other stuff (we've had very little rain in the last few weeks in this area).

The greens are exceptionally slow (5-6 stimp?). I told my wife this is what it was like putting back in the 1960s.

There are also several tee shots where you'll need to work around overhanging branches (on #11, from the forward tees, my wife would have to aim at the bunker to the left side of the green, as tree branches blocked the direct approach. I had the same issue on a few tee shots from the blue tees, which forced me to hit some different drives to keep the ball in play.

The staff and crew are friendly, and with some work/$$, they could make this an enjoyable course. There are a lot of holes with good shot values, but several where you just don't know quite what to do either off the tee or with a layup. By all means, use a range finder/Garmin when playing here.
